Power Source Compatibility

Power source compatibility is a primary consideration because most portable tire inflators are designed for a 12V vehicle outlet, making them easy to use on the road, while dual-power models with 12V DC and 110V AC support add convenience for both roadside and home inflation. Buyers should verify that the inflator matches their intended use, especially if it will be stored in a car for emergencies or used regularly in a garage. Attention should also turn to maximum pressure ratings, since tire needs vary widely across vehicles and bicycles. Cord and hose length matter as well; longer reach can reduce the need to reposition the vehicle. Noise level is another practical factor, as quieter units improve comfort during operation and repeated use.

Inflation Speed

Inflation speed is a key factor because it determines how quickly a portable tire inflator can get a vehicle back on the road, with many models delivering about 30 to 35 L/min for practical everyday use. At that range, a standard mid-sized car tire may go from 0 to 36 PSI in roughly 4 to 6 minutes, though results depend on hose design, motor efficiency, and battery output. Some higher-performing units can complete a similar task in as little as 1.08 minutes at a set pressure. Airflow capacity, often expressed in CFM, also matters because greater flow can shorten inflation time for larger tires or inflatables. Buyers should compare real-world speed claims, not just headline numbers, to judge convenience.

Maximum Pressure

Maximum pressure becomes the next key specification once inflation speed is understood, because a portable tire inflator must be able to reach the PSI required by the tires it serves. Car tires commonly need 30 to 80 PSI, while bicycle tires may demand as much as 150 PSI. Larger vehicles, including SUVs and trucks, can require more than 60 PSI, so a unit with a higher pressure ceiling offers broader usefulness. Higher maximum pressure often supports faster inflation, reducing wait time during routine maintenance. Many models also include automatic shut-off at the preset PSI, which helps prevent over-inflation and improves safety. Buyers should also review duty cycle ratings, since they show how long the inflator can run before cooling.

Hose Length

Hose length is a practical factor that affects how easily a portable tire inflator can reach each tire without constant repositioning. Shorter hoses, sometimes around 1.8 feet, may suit compact setups but can limit placement options near certain wheels. Longer hoses, extending past 15 feet in some models, improve reach and make it easier to service larger vehicles or awkward parking positions. A hose around 11.5 feet can often reach both sides of a vehicle without moving the unit. That added flexibility matters when space is tight or the inflator must sit farther away from the tire. Storage should also be considered, since longer hoses usually need more room and tidier management.

Noise Level

Noise level is another practical factor to weigh after hose length, especially if the inflator will be used near homes, in parking lots, or late at night. Portable tire inflators vary widely, from about 65 dB, roughly normal conversation, to as much as 92 dB, akin to a vacuum cleaner or loud music. Lower-output models are often preferable in residential areas or during nighttime use, where limiting disturbance matters. Louder units may still be acceptable in roadside or emergency situations, where rapid inflation takes priority over sound. Frequent operation near other people also makes noise worth checking, since prolonged exposure above 85 dB can affect hearing. Reviewing the listed noise specification helps balance operating comfort with performance expectations.

Auto Shut-Off

Auto shut-off is a valuable safety feature in portable tire inflators, automatically stopping inflation once the preset PSI is reached. This function helps prevent over-inflation, reducing the risk of tire damage and improving overall safety. Many modern inflators with digital gauges let users select an exact pressure, which adds accuracy and convenience. The mechanism usually activates when the target PSI is met or after a preset time, so the user does not need to watch the process constantly. That reduced oversight is useful in low-light situations and during routine top-offs. It also limits unnecessary motor strain, which can help extend the inflator’s service life. For drivers seeking efficiency, consistency, and peace of mind, auto shut-off remains a practical feature worth prioritizing.

Built-In Lighting

Built-in lighting on portable tire inflators can make a major difference during nighttime emergencies, helping users find the valve and operate the unit safely in low-light conditions. Bright LED lamps often illuminate the area around a vehicle, reducing mistakes and improving safety while air is added. Some units also include a flashlight function, which can help signal for assistance or support other roadside tasks. Because these lights usually draw little power, they can be used without heavily taxing the vehicle battery. Durability matters as well, since weather-resistant housings help the lighting remain functional in rain, dust, or cold. For drivers who travel after dark, integrated lighting adds practical value beyond inflation alone and can be an important feature when selecting a portable tire inflator.

Frequently Asked Questions

How Often Should I Calibrate My Portable Tire Inflator?

It should be calibrated every 6 to 12 months, or sooner if readings seem inaccurate. Frequent use, drops, extreme temperatures, or noticeable pressure discrepancies justify earlier checks. If the inflator is used commercially or for safety-critical tires, more regular calibration is wise. A simple comparison with a trusted pressure gauge can reveal drift. Consistent calibration helps maintain accurate inflation, better tire wear, and safer driving overall.

Can Portable Inflators Safely Inflate Truck Tires?

Yes, portable inflators can safely inflate truck tires, but only if the unit matches the tire’s required pressure and flow. Nearly 40% of roadside tire-related breakdowns involve underinflation, highlighting the value of proper maintenance. A detached assessment would note that small inflators often work slowly on large truck tires and may overheat. For best results, the device should be rated for high PSI, continuous duty, and heavy-duty applications.

Do Portable Tire Inflators Work in Freezing Temperatures?

Yes, portable tire inflators can work in freezing temperatures, though performance often drops. Cold air thickens seals, batteries lose efficiency, and motors may run less smoothly, so inflation can take longer. A detached observer would note that corded models usually handle cold better than battery-powered ones. It is also wise to store the device indoors and check pressure after inflation, since tire readings change considerably in low temperatures.

How Do I Store a Tire Inflator to Prevent Damage?

It is best stored in a clean, dry case, away from moisture, direct sunlight, and extreme temperatures. The hose, cord, and nozzles should be coiled loosely to avoid kinks or cracks. The battery should be charged to the maker’s recommended level, then checked periodically. Dust and debris should be removed before storage. It should not be left in a hot trunk or damp garage for long periods.
